Scott Takeo Aoki is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Infectious Diseases and Aging. According to data from OpenAlex, Scott Takeo Aoki has authored 14 papers receiving a total of 443 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 7 papers in Molecular Biology, 6 papers in Infectious Diseases and 4 papers in Aging. Recurrent topics in Scott Takeo Aoki's work include Viral gastroenteritis research and epidemiology (4 papers), Genetics, Aging, and Longevity in Model Organisms (4 papers) and RNA Research and Splicing (4 papers). Scott Takeo Aoki is often cited by papers focused on Viral gastroenteritis research and epidemiology (4 papers), Genetics, Aging, and Longevity in Model Organisms (4 papers) and RNA Research and Splicing (4 papers). Scott Takeo Aoki collaborates with scholars based in United States, New Zealand and Australia. Scott Takeo Aoki's co-authors include Stephen C. Harrison, Philip R. Dormitzer, Ethan C. Settembre, Harry B. Greenberg, Shane D. Trask, Zhe Chen, Xing Zhang, Nikolaus Grigorieff, A.R. Bellamy and Judith Kimble and has published in prestigious journals such as Science,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ences and Journal of Biological Chemistry.
